Offer them an incentive to close it by then. I offered mine a free SB for closing by the 28th to give me plenty of time to submit. You could do a bigger product since you are needing it to close on the same night.

And if you add it to the host order then you get to use their discount and make commission on it, so, it would really cost less than what you think.
